San Diego City Employees Retirement System is a public pension fund based in San Diego, California. Established in 1927, the plan administers three separate single-employer defined benefit pension plans for the City, Port, and Airport. SDCERS provides service retirement, disability retirement, death, and survivor benefits to its participants. The assets of the pension fund are managed by a 13 member board of administration, responsible for the prudent administration of retirement benefits for City, Port and Airport employees and for overseeing the investment portfolio of the retirement systems trust fund. The board is assisted by the investment committee which is responsible for monitoring investment performance and market conditions and recommending changes to the investment policy statement.
